Stéphane Raimbault
|
93a05986fc
Unit test for baud rate check and error message
|
11 rokov pred |
Stéphane Raimbault
|
bdd5379af5
Switch test programs to a BSD license
|
11 rokov pred |
Stéphane Raimbault
|
83c3410267
Fix remote buffer overflow vulnerability on write requests
|
11 rokov pred |
Stéphane Raimbault
|
c1665d400c
Filter of IP addresses in IPv4 server (closes #190)
|
11 rokov pred |
Stéphane Raimbault
|
8f1cc7b3c8
Allow to listen any hosts in IPv6 (closes #32)
|
11 rokov pred |
Stéphane Raimbault
|
bb6be03c11
Convenient assert macro for unit testing
|
11 rokov pred |
Stéphane Raimbault
|
55bd5054e6
Initialize device argument to NULL on malloc (closes #184)
|
11 rokov pred |
Stéphane Raimbault
|
52a82f8cfe
Truncate data from response in report_slave_id to new max arg (closes #167)
|
11 rokov pred |
Stéphane Raimbault
|
5665306800
Fix response timeout modification on connect (closes #80)
|
11 rokov pred |
Stéphane Raimbault
|
c4f7a24285
Change timeout to uint32 and add 3 byte timeout tests
|
11 rokov pred |
Stéphane Raimbault
|
ea80f74094
New API for set/get response and byte timeouts
|
11 rokov pred |
Stéphane Raimbault
|
8941a84cee
Export Modbus function codes supported by libmodbus
|
11 rokov pred |
Stéphane Raimbault
|
780e1c2365
Support RTU in new raw requests tests
|
11 rokov pred |
Stéphane Raimbault
|
05d1670465
Tests on reading 0 or max + 1 registers for function 0x17
|
11 rokov pred |
Stéphane Raimbault
|
6cfed42b5e
Slight refactor of unit-test-client
|
11 rokov pred |
Stéphane Raimbault
|
fc73565da7
Fix remote buffer overflow vulnerability (closes #25, #105)
|
11 rokov pred |
Stéphane Raimbault
|
ef81a69e7b
Avoid a level of imbrication in bandwidth-server-many-up
|
12 rokov pred |
Stéphane Raimbault
|
692f6b76f7
Rename modbus_set_float_swapped to modbus_set_float_dcba
|
12 rokov pred |
Stéphane Raimbault
|
997231b799
New functions to set/get swapped floats (LSB)
|
12 rokov pred |
Stéphane Raimbault
|
8bb8be2d9f
Add comment about fix alignment problem
|
12 rokov pred |
Alexander Dahl
|
9782a3044f
Fix alignment problem
|
12 rokov pred |
Stéphane Raimbault
|
2dca04230e
Return value of _modbus_tcp_pi_connect() on failure (closes #61)
|
12 rokov pred |
Stéphane Raimbault
|
8d8349b860
Display node and service in PI and port in IPv4 at connection
|
13 rokov pred |
Stéphane Raimbault
|
c1e2e0b319
New RTU receive() to ignore confirmation from other slaves (closes #18)
|
13 rokov pred |
Stéphane Raimbault
|
a6e63d7d20
Fix typo in message found by Christian Leutloff
|
13 rokov pred |
Stéphane Raimbault
|
1941fd4aa9
Check slave only in RTU backend and add unit tests
|
13 rokov pred |
Stéphane Raimbault
|
ad80a6d3cc
Enhanced report slave ID and documentation
|
13 rokov pred |
Stéphane Raimbault
|
a2e41db386
Renamed modbus_read_and_write_registers to modbus_write_and_read_registers
|
13 rokov pred |
Stéphane Raimbault
|
d1f1854338
New error recovery modes: link and protocol
|
13 rokov pred |
Stéphane Raimbault
|
bb23b4abfa
Remove set but unused req_lenth and address in unit tests
|
14 rokov pred |